What is Freezer Burn?
Freezer burn occurs when frozen food is exposed to cold, dry air, causing the water molecules on its surface to sublimate (change directly from a solid to a gas) more quickly than they can be replenished. This leads to the formation of dehydrated areas, which can become discolored and develop an unpleasant texture. Freezer burn can affect any type of frozen food, but it’s more common in foods with high water content, such as meats, vegetables, and fruits.
Causes of Freezer Burn
Several factors contribute to the development of freezer burn:
- Inadequate packaging: If food is not properly wrapped or sealed, it can be exposed to cold, dry air, leading to freezer burn.
- Temperature fluctuations: Changes in freezer temperature can cause the formation of ice crystals, which can lead to freezer burn.
- Storage time: The longer food is stored in the freezer, the higher the risk of freezer burn.
- Freezer humidity: Low humidity in the freezer can contribute to the development of freezer burn.
Effects of Freezer Burn on Food Quality
Freezer burn can significantly impact the quality of your food, affecting its texture, flavor, and appearance. Some common effects of freezer burn include:
- Dehydration: Freezer burn can cause food to become dehydrated, leading to a tough, leathery texture.
- Discoloration: Affected areas can become discolored, turning grayish-brown or developing white spots.
- Flavor changes: Freezer burn can cause food to develop off-flavors or become tasteless.
- Nutrient loss: Freezer burn can lead to a loss of nutrients, particularly water-soluble vitamins like vitamin C and B vitamins.

Preventing Freezer Burn
Preventing freezer burn is relatively straightforward. Here are some tips to help you keep your frozen food fresh:
- Use airtight containers: Store food in airtight, moisture-proof containers to prevent exposure to cold, dry air.
- Label and date containers: Keep track of storage times and contents to ensure you use the oldest items first.
- Store food at 0°F (-18°C) or below: Maintain a consistent freezer temperature to prevent temperature fluctuations.
- Minimize storage time: Use frozen food within a few months to minimize the risk of freezer burn.
